Barriers to pest invasion
Abstract
Barrier devices against pest invasion are provided that allow sealing around a utility penetration ( 8 ), for example a pipe or conduit. In one embodiment, the barrier device is a barrier boot ( 2 ) that is sealed to a foundation slab ( 50 ), in order to prevent pest invasion through the spaces ( 52 ) formed between the foundation slab ( 50 ) and the utility penetration ( 8 ). In another embodiment, the device forms a continuous barrier with a surface receiving the utility penetration, for example a sheet-type barrier, a building foundation, footer or wall. In yet another embodiment, the device is a stand alone product which provides protection when embedded in concrete.
